Alternate names: X-bows, Arbalests

Note, this is NOT for the siege weapons that share the same shape (ballistae).

Crossbows were infamous when they were invented since they made full plate armor absolutely useless, the bolt could easily penetrate the protective metal and fatally wound the person supposedly protected from all harm. This allowed a completely untrained peasant to trivially kill a knight who had years of experience behind them despite their heavy armor. However, modern body armor can block crossbow bolts due to their need to block bullets (though conversely modern armor tends to be quite useless against blunt weapons like hammers).
